Drawing on self-determination theory, this study explores how paradoxical leadership stimulates voice behavior among generation Y hotel employees by focusing on the chain mediating role of employees' psychological safety and job crafting. Using data from 322 validated supervisor-subordinate pairs across 34 Chinese hotels via a three-wave survey, the results show that paradoxical leadership motivates employees to make constructive suggestions or identify operational inefficiencies, thereby increasing organizational efficiency. Psychological safety and job crafting exhibit a chain mediating effect in the link between paradoxical leadership and employee voice behavior. This study contributes to the hospitality literature by highlighting the under-researched mechanisms linking paradoxical leadership and voice behavior in Generation Y and the implications for hotel managers' practice.
